- 当你的爬虫遇到验证码时该怎么办?神级程序员:这是最实 01-08
- 程序员编程工具下载的5种方法,你用过几种? 01-08
- 神级程序员教你如何渗透测试军火库!这个操作只能用66 01-08
- 2018年WEB开发顶级编程语言 01-08
- 干货分享,教你用PHP做“网页计算器”,简单又实用! 01-08
- Python高居编程首位,分享几个程序员笑话,一般人 01-08
- 教你利用PHP制作一个奇葩聊天机器人 01-08
- 编程安全是门学问——PHP安全编程 01-08
- 前端开发人员:如果连这个都不懂那真是不合格了! 01-08
- yii2 composer安装介绍 01-08
当你的爬虫遇到验证码时该怎么办?神级程序员:这是最实用的方法
发布者: superzhang | 发布时间:2018-01-08昨天断更了,小编在此说抱歉了,昨天有事情耽搁了,所以就没来得及给大家更新!
回归正题,写爬虫写了这么多,关于验证码的问题,好像我没给大家写过解决办法,今天呢,我就专门写个验证码的,而且是跟模拟登陆结合起来写。相当于一文解决两个问题,说的太满了。是一文开个头写了两方面的问题。
首
程序员编程工具下载的5种方法,你用过几种?
发布者: superzhang | 发布时间:2018-01-08此前,w3cschool跟程序员小伙伴分享了程序员必备的6大强大的工具这篇文章。
很多小伙伴收藏了这篇干货,不过可能不一定有去下载这些神器。
由于最近有不少的粉丝在后台私信,编程工具怎么下载,到哪些网站下载?
所以,今天w3cschool就给小伙伴们讲解一下这个问题,用下面这5种方式,可以说几乎可以下载任何的编程工具。
0、Github比如程序员大神在上面上传了各种的软件、工具,程序员小伙伴们不妨下载看看。
当然,也有其他的开发者在这个平台上上传了一些不错的神器,都是相当值得一看的。
涵括了各种的在线工具,比如C 在线开发编译IDE、在线
神级程序员教你如何渗透测试军火库!这个操作只能用666来表达!
发布者: superzhang | 发布时间:2018-01-08前面的话:将近一年的闭关学习,一直没有时间更新新的内容,先给大家说一声抱歉了,日后定会持续输出高质量的干货内容,在此先推一篇用Python作为编程语言的大量优质渗透测试工具。
Requests:允许你自动发送 HTTP 请求,而不需要手动操作。不需要手动将查询字符串添加到你的URL,或者对你的POST数据进行表单编码。小编推荐大家加一下这个群:103456743这个群里好几千人了!大家遇到啥问题都会在里面交流!而且免费分享零基础入门料资料web开发 爬虫资料一整套!是个非常好的学习交流地方!也有程序员大神给大家热心解答各种问题!很快满员了。欲进从速哦!各种PDF等你来下载!全部都是免
2018年WEB开发顶级编程语言
发布者: superzhang | 发布时间:2018-01-08什么是网页设计?
“网页设计涵盖了网站生产和维护方面的许多不同的技能和学科。”
在我看来,
“网页设计就是你思考和修改的能力,只是基于你如何实现你的网页设计知识。”
网页设计是制作网页或网站的过程。如果您对网页设计感兴趣,并寻找一些必要的编程语言和开发,那么您正在阅读正确的文章。在这里,我正在为您提供用于学习Web设计和开发的编程语言列表。这是他们是:
1. JAVASCRIPT设计:Brendon Eich
Javascript是Web开发中被广泛接受和有效的编程语言。它
为你的网站增加了交互性。一般来说,Java Script用于为你的网页添加动画,在页面上加载脚本和
干货分享,教你用PHP做“网页计算器”,简单又实用!5分钟就能学会
发布者: superzhang | 发布时间:2018-01-08首先,我们分析一下网页结构,构造出我们这个网页该如何设计?
画图工具为ProcessOn可私信小编获取
接下来就是代码实现了。嗯,基本上跟画的差不多了。逃:-)
接下来就是功能的实现了。入门篇
大学时候,刚学会上网,于是在网上搜片,然后搜出个PHP大全.rmvb。以为是热片大全,谁知道竟然是PHP的视频教程,于是就学会了PHP……\(╯-╰)/
某程序员退休后决定练习书法,于是重金购买文房四宝。一日,饭后突生雅兴,一番研墨拟纸,并点上上好檀香。定神片刻,泼墨挥毫,郑重地写下一行字:hello world!
单身篇
程序员问禅师:"大师,我身体健康思想端正,各方面都不错,为何没有女朋友?" 禅师笑答:"原因很简单,不过若想知道,需先写一段java代码。" 青年略一沉吟,写完了。"再写一段C#。
教你利用PHP制作一个奇葩聊天机器人
发布者: superzhang | 发布时间:2018-01-08各位条子,大家上午好!
今天由小编来教大家 如何利用PHP制作一个奇葩聊天机器人!
小提示!小白可能比较难懂哦!
由于源码比较长,需要的朋友可以私聊小编哦!
废话不多说,上源码!
<?php
namespace BotMan\BotMan;
use Closure;
use Illuminate\Support\Collection;
use BotMan\BotMan\Commands\Command;
use BotMan\BotMan\Messages\Matcher;
use BotMan\BotMan\Drivers\DriverManager;
use BotMan\BotMan\Traits\ProvidesStorage;
use BotMan\BotMan\Interfaces\UserInterface;
use Bot
编程安全是门学问——PHP安全编程
发布者: superzhang | 发布时间:2018-01-08##register_globals的安全性 本特性已自php5.3.0起废弃并自PHP5.4.0起移除,故不作研究。
##不要让不相关的人看到报错信息
只要关闭display_errors就可以做到,如果你希望得到出错信息,可以打开log_errors选项,并在error_log选项中设置出错日志文件的保存路径。
所有的出错报告级别可以在任意级别进行修改。
PHP允许通过set_error_handler()函数指定自己的出错处理函数。
##网站安全设计的一些原则
深度防范:冗余安全措施
最小权限:只能给予每个人完成他本职工作所必须的尽量少的权限。
简单就是美:没有必要的复杂与没有必要的风险一样糟糕。
暴露最小化:数据暴露必须尽量最小化。
##可用性与数据跟踪
平衡风险与可用性:用户操作的友好性与安全措施是一对矛盾,在提高安全性的同时,通常会降低可用性。尽量是安全措施对用户透明。<
前端开发人员:如果连这个都不懂那真是不合格了!
发布者: superzhang | 发布时间:2018-01-08
1.什么是正则表达式
正则表达式是一个描述字符模式的对象。
正则表达式是具有特殊语法的字符串,用来表示指定字符或字符串在另一个字符串中出现的情况。
正则表达式是指一个用来描述或者匹配一系列符合某个句法规则的字符串的单个字符串。
作用:验证字符串、查找字符串、替换字符串、提取字符串
典型场景:表单验证、网络爬虫、编写底层框架、日志分析
2.正则的构成
定界符 // 模式规则 模式修正符 gim
例如 /javascript/gi
注意事项: 正则是一门独立的语言,各种语言都支持对正则的使用, 在JavaScript中,直接使用//作为定界符即可,不需要加单引号或双引号,在PHP中,则需要加上单引号或双引号,最好是使用单引号。
正则有两个系列,一是perl系列,二是posix系列。目前使用较多的是perl系列,效率稍高,js实现的只有perl系列,而php则两种都实现了。
yii2 composer安装介绍
发布者: superzhang | 发布时间:2018-01-08yii2是一个很流行的php web开发框架,模块化设计,高扩展性,可以用来快速开发网站,restful风格接口
有功能强大的脚手架程序gii模块 ,有强大的调试跟踪debug模块,多级别的日志记录功能,支持多种pgsql、sqlite、redis、mysql、mongo等多种db,文件、redis、memcache多种缓存。
还有行为和事件,可以方便的对模块类功能进行扩展,是PHP开发者值得学习和研究的一个框架。
我们今天来简单介绍一下yii的安装,源码包直接下载解压就可以使用,下面介绍composer方式安装,composer安装的优势是模块的升级和安装全部命令化,更方便操作。
1. composer 安装
1.1 安装 composer(已安装的跳过)
windows
到 https://getcomposer.org/download/ 找对应的下载链接;
linux:
curl -sS https://getcomposer.org/installer | php
2. 更新到最新版本,如果不是最新会有更新提示
composer self-update
3. 安装支持插件
为了兼容npm和bower ,主要用
